As a Development Manager on the Infrastructure Platform (IP) team, you will lead teams that build and operate everything from the network backbone to the servers in our datacenter and in the cloud, to the services that run the operate the servers globally, to the platform that game developers use to deploy and operate the game at all phases of development while protecting our IP and players experience. This team powers the services and infrastructure behind League of Legends and paving the way for future games. We operate at a scale that challenges us to improve and shorten the time to achieve new features and value to the players.
Within IP, we’re looking for Development Managers who have leadership, technical curiosity, so they manage all aspects of delivery throughout the development and operating lifecycle. They will work with engineering managers and product managers to develop a shared vision for the development of our backend infrastructure and services to ensure game teams can meet their needs and so that players have an exceptional experience.
